Depends on what type of fishing you want to do.
Saltwater-The piers are going to be the best and cheapest places. However, all people will need to get a fishing license.
For fresh water there are a couple of great places to go. Try Santa Ana river lakes or even Corona lakes. Both are about $18 to get in and require NO License. Corona is the better of the 2 for Trout and catfish.
